MEMORANDUM OPINION
Relators, Fluid Power Equipment, Inc., Peerless Enterprises, and Robert N.
Shell, have filed a petition for writ of mandamus challenging the trial courtโs April
12, 2022 order denying their motion to stay arbitration.1 Relators assert that the
1
The underlying case is Fluid Power Equipment, Inc., Peerless Enterprises, and
Robert Noble Shell v. Deborah P. Wilson, as Independent Executrix of the Estate
of John William Wilson, Cause No. 2022-06158, in the 157th District Court of
Harris County, Texas, the Honorable Tanya Garrison presiding.
arbitration they seek to stay attempts to โre-arbitrate and re-litigate an alleged
mistakeโ made in an earlier arbitration award that was confirmed by the trial court
in 2019. According to relators, they seek โto vindicate the policies that favor
arbitration and the finality of [the earlier arbitration] award.โ
We deny relatorsโ petition for writ of mandamus. All pending motions are
dismissed as moot.
